Why Does My Car Pull to One Side?

So first of all, let's make sure we determine that it's actually a pull. So if you let go of your steering wheel and let the car just drive itself, and it drifts to one side or the other then that's what we would call a pull.

If you're holding the steering wheel and the car pulls, it may just be a steering wheel off-center, so make sure that it's not just the steering wheel’s off center, but the car is actually pulling. So if it's actually pulling the most common thing that we see is actually tire rolling resistance. So there's some sort of internal issue with the tires.

Fairly easy to evaluate, we simply take the 2 front tires and cross them from side to side. If the pull changes then we know it’s caused by the tires. Secondly, we need to do a really good thorough suspension inspection because perhaps we have a suspension component that is either worn and it's shifted a little bit, or maybe even it's bent or something like that.

So a suspension part like control arms and things like that can cause a drift or a pull as well. And then the last thing we look at is we look at the alignment. If the alignment is off, then we can adjust it and and then we can straighten it out the 2 kinds of things that cause pulling or drifting are caster, which is something you can't physically see, and camber, which you can't fully see by the eye either but a machine can.

So imagine that we have this tire in and this tire straight it’s gonna to want to go this way. But casters are kind of like the wheels on your office chair. Where they turn and follow what you're trying to do and that you can't physically see we have to take that up on a machine. The last thing I just want to point out is in all cases we want to make sure that the tire pressure is set properly because if it's uneven, it can cause a car to drift as well.
